本文目录导读:
随着互联网的普及,域名已经成为我们日常生活中不可或缺的一部分,我们通过域名访问网站、进行在线购物、获取信息等,很多人对域名背后的服务器查询技术知之甚少,本文将深入解析域名的服务器查询,带您领略域名背后的技术奥秘。
图片来源于网络,如有侵权联系删除
域名与IP地址的关系
1、域名:域名是互联网上用于识别和定位计算机的字符名称,便于人们记忆和访问,www.baidu.com就是一个域名。
2、IP地址:IP地址是互联网上用于标识计算机的数字地址,相当于每台计算机在网络中的身份证号码,8.8.8.8是谷歌公共Dns服务器的IP地址。
域名与IP地址的关系:域名与IP地址是相对应的,域名解析就是将域名转换为对应的IP地址,使得我们能够通过域名访问网站。
域名服务器查询原理
1、域名解析过程:当我们输入一个域名时,浏览器会向域名服务器发送请求,查询该域名对应的IP地址。
2、域名服务器类型:域名服务器主要分为以下几种类型:
(1)权威域名服务器:负责解析特定域名的IP地址,如.com、.cn等顶级域名。
(2)根域名服务器:负责解析顶级域名(如.com、.cn等)的IP地址。
图片来源于网络,如有侵权联系删除
(3)递归域名服务器:负责查询整个域名解析过程,将查询结果返回给客户端。
(4)迭代域名服务器:负责查询部分域名解析过程,将查询结果返回给递归域名服务器。
3、域名服务器查询流程:
(1)客户端发送查询请求,请求域名解析。
(2)递归域名服务器接收到请求后,向根域名服务器查询顶级域名解析。
(3)根域名服务器返回顶级域名解析结果,递归域名服务器继续查询二级域名解析。
(4)二级域名服务器返回解析结果,递归域名服务器继续查询三级域名解析。
图片来源于网络,如有侵权联系删除
(5)三级域名服务器返回解析结果,递归域名服务器将IP地址返回给客户端。
域名服务器查询优化
1、DNS缓存:为了提高域名解析速度,DNS服务器会将解析结果缓存一段时间,下次查询时直接从缓存中获取,减少查询次数。
2、多线路解析:多线路解析技术可以将域名解析请求分发到多个DNS服务器,提高解析速度和稳定性。
3、域名解析优化:优化域名解析配置,如调整解析记录的TTL值、启用DNSSEC等,提高域名解析的安全性和可靠性。
域名服务器查询是互联网技术的重要组成部分,它保证了我们能够通过域名访问网站,了解域名服务器查询原理,有助于我们更好地使用互联网,随着互联网技术的不断发展,域名服务器查询技术也在不断优化,为用户提供更优质的服务。
标签: #域名的服务器查询
评论列表